What is Accident Lawsuit Representation?
Accident lawsuit representation refers to the legal services provided by attorneys who specialize in personal injury cases arising from accidents. These attorneys advocate on behalf of accident victims, helping them protected compensation for their injuries, medical costs, lost earnings, and more.

Just how much does it cost to hire an accident attorney?
A lot of personal injury lawyers deal with a contingency cost basis, indicating they just make money if you win your case. Their fees normally range from 20% to 40% of the settlement or award.

4. Can I still submit a lawsuit if I was partially at fault?
Yes, numerous states permit relative neglect, suggesting you can still recover damages even if you were partially responsible for the accident, though your compensation may be minimized based upon your percentage of fault.
5. What kinds of damages can I claim?
Victims may claim different damages, consisting of medical expenditures, lost wages, pain and suffering, emotional distress, and home damage.
